Ptio is a SaaS platform for parametrizing Prompts using CVS, Excel or images from ZIP. This allows you to use a Prompt template thousands of times to generate or transform content at scale.
Ptio includes a library of data transformation steps to reshape inputs or structure outputs, and you can extend it with your own transformations using standard SQL.
